Output 65d089fb1b6d7e890837ebc451dd4d05eabd57d2ce8a24cc89618f74e6fe532e:0

value
181133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f844fdacbe9152f86dba152f8431d3e6cbef676 OP_EQUAL
address
3DKGF6n9953k23NpXttv173GqhZf5ToxRd
transaction
65d089fb1b6d7e890837ebc451dd4d05eabd57d2ce8a24cc89618f74e6fe532e
confirmations
301065
spent
true